Andrewâ??s Bodyweight 1080 Workout (Repeat as circuit with 2 minutes rest between each):
3 x 60 Push-ups
3 x 60 Bodyweight Squats
3 x 60 Calf Raisers
3 x 60 Reverse Crunches
3 x 60 Crunches
3 x 60 Reverse Push-ups
